iPLEX® HS Lung Panel
The iPLEX® HS Lung Panel is a practical tool for NSCLC (Non-small cell lung cancer) tumor profiling, capable of detecting 70 key mutations in genes like BRAF, EGFR, ERBB2, KRAS, and PIK3CA. Designed for efficiency, it requires minimal DNA, identifies low-frequency variants, and is compatible with various sample types, reducing sample rejection rates in labs.

iPLEX® HS Lung Panel: Simplifying NSCLC Tumor Profiling
Non-small cell lung cancer (NSCLC) is a significant health issue, requiring precise tumor profiling for effective treatment. Traditional NSCLC mutation profiling often struggles with limited or poor-quality samples, leading to high rates of sample rejection.
Key Features of the iPLEX® HS Lung Panel
The iPLEX® HS Lung Panel is designed to address these issues in NSCLC testing:
- Detects a Range of Mutations: It can identify 70 important mutations across critical genes, such as:
- BRAF: Codons 469 (exon 11), 594, 600 (exon 15).
- EGFR: Exon 19 indels, exon 20 insertions, substitutions in exons 18, 19, 20, and 21.
- ERBB2: Exon 20 insertions.
- KRAS: Codons 12, 13 (exon 2), and 61 (exon 3).
- PIK3CA: Codons 542, 545 (exon 9), and 1047 (exon 20).
- Sensitive to Low Frequency Variants: It’s capable of identifying variants with as low as 1% variant allele frequency.
- Requires Minimal DNA: The panel works with just 10 ng of DNA, useful for samples where DNA is scarce.
- Quick and Efficient: It only takes 1 hour of hands-on time and a total of 8 hours from start to finish.
- Works with Various Sample Types: The panel is effective with challenging samples like FFPE tissue, needle biopsies, and pleural fluid.
- Lowers Sample Rejection: Its ability to handle lower quality samples and detect small DNA yields reduces the likelihood of rejecting samples.

- iPLEX® HS Lung Panel kit: PCR primers, extension primers, termination mixes
- PCR reagent set
- iPLEX pro reagent set: SAP buffer, SAP enzyme, iPLEX pro buffer plus, iPLEX pro enzyme, iPLEX pro termination mix, 3-pt calibrant.
- SpectroCHIP arrays
- Clean resin
